Each year we offer up to eight full time
places where we consider that a child’s home life may affect their progress and
well being.
The following list gives examples of
the kind of child that would be offered a full time place, although we
will always consider other circumstances.
-
Children showing a delay in
their development, such as speech difficulty, which may have been
noted by a Health Visitor
-
Children with physical
difficulties living some distance from school and experiencing
transport problems
-
Children displaying emotional or
behavioural difficulties or delays
-
Children living in inadequate
housing, such as cramped living space with little or no garden
-
Children living with a single
parent who may need support (either through death or divorce)
-
Children with parents, brothers,
sisters or other dependent family members suffering with an illness
or disability
-
Children with parents who have
learning difficulties which may also affect the child’s development
-
Children from families receiving
support from Social Services
-
Children from families with a
number of younger brothers/sisters
-
Children living away from their
immediate families
Before offering places we may speak
to other professionals to ask for their advice. The final decision
rests with the school’s
Governing body.
